package main
import "testing"
func TestMetaDataKey(t *testing.T) {
tests := []struct {
in MetaDataKey
valid bool
name string
version string
}{
{
in: "fp.topics.0.18",
valid: true,
name: "topics",
version: "0.18",
},
{
in: "fp.topics.0",
valid: false,
},
{
in: "topics.0.18",
valid: false,
},
}
for _, test := range tests {
t.Run(string(test.in), func(t *testing.T) {
valid := test.in.Valid()
if valid != test.valid {
t.Errorf("expected valid %T, got %T", test.valid, valid)
return
}
if valid {
name := test.in.Name()
if name != test.name {
t.Errorf("expected name %s, got %s", test.name, name)
}
version := test.in.Version()
if version != test.version {
t.Errorf("expected version %s, got %s", test.version, version)
}
}
})
}
}
func TestDataKey(t *testing.T) {
tests := []struct {
in DataKey
valid bool
name string
}{
{
in: "fp.topics",
valid: true,
name: "topics",
},
{
in: "fp",
valid: false,
},
{
in: "xp.topics",
valid: false,
},
}
for _, test := range tests {
t.Run(string(test.in), func(t *testing.T) {
valid := test.in.Valid()
if valid != test.valid {
t.Errorf("expected valid %T, got %T", test.valid, valid)
return
}
if valid {
name := test.in.Name()
if name != test.name {
t.Errorf("expected name %s, got %s", test.name, name)
}
}
})
}
}
